Hmm.. You wont like this but sounds like you have found one with a bad steering motor. I have not had one apart, but there are bearings in the steering colum that can cause the wheel to not turn, the other is the steering motor is slipping. The 1600 I believe has a saginaw steering motor ( hard to find parts for ) but can be replaced with a charlynn motor ( gets expensive with all the fittings and adaptors needed ). Dont have their number, but miabach's (sp??) in Ohio is an excellent resource.
